I had been lusting over MAC brushes for quite a while and on the same day I visited Stratford-Upon-Avon with a few of my flatmates, I was lucky enough to pop into the MAC shop afterwards where I had a bit of a naughty splurge. The first brush, 204, is normally used for mascara, though I decided to use it for my eyebrows and, yes, its been good, but in all honesty, I could of just bought a cheaper one and I'm sure it would have just done the same job. On the other hand 263 has been a wonder. My eyebrows have never looked so good and my boyfriend keeps making comments about how my eyebrows look 'on point' (though I'm sure he doesn't really know what he's on about). Lastly is the 217, which I'm sure most of you have heard A LOT about. I have wanted the 217 for such a long time as I have heard so many bloggers talk about how amazing it is and I can now agree that it is, in fact, incredible. I don't want to harp on about it too much because I'm sure you've heard enough about it, but my eye shadow has never looked so good (although my bank balance is cursing me right now!)

Lastly, on the same day I bought Breath of Fresh Air, toner water. I love the smell of this, I cant really describe it other than it smells very fresh (as it claims) when sprayed on my face it feels so cooling and it just feels like it will benefit my skin so much - which it has. I spray it every evening, after I've taken my make up off and I just take a simple cotton pad and wipe it all off my face - which then takes off the remainder of my make up. When I wake up in the morning, my skin is so soft and fresh and I just love it.
